Kate MiddletonandPrince Williamare making theirEasterdebut — both as the Prince and Princess of Wales and with all three of their children!

The couple stepped out alongside other members of the royal family for theEaster church serviceat St. George’s Chapel in Windsor Castle on Sunday. For the first time, they made the holiday outing as a family of five — althoughPrince George, 9, andPrincess Charlotte, 7,joined their parents at the eventin 2022, 4-year-oldPrince Louisalsotagged along for the Easter servicethis year.

The Wales family coordinated in blue ensembles, which was also the color of choice for King Charles and Queen Camilla for the church visit. Blue seems to be a go-to color forPrince Williamand Princess Kate for family portraits, who also dressed in the color for their2022 Christmas cardand last year’sTrooping the Colour parade.

Princess Kate wore a Catherine Walker & Co coat dress that shepreviously wore at the 2022 Commonwealth Day Service, and completed the look with a blue version of her Lock & Co pillbox hat that she wore last year for St. Patricks Day. And although she normally favors neutral nail polish colors, Kate opted for a bold red shade for the Easter outing.

Princess Charlottesported afloral dressBritish children’s wear designer Rachel Riley with blue tights under a navy coat. After the church service, Charlotte ditched her coat — and Kate was seen carrying it as they walked away from St. George’s Chapel.

Prince Louis' Easter debut came just a few months after hejoined the royals at their Christmas Day church outingfor the first time.

Prince George and Princess Charlotte are quickly becoming pros at traditional royal events. The two eldest Wales kids are now old enough to join the family at many outings, including the Christmas walk, amemorial service for their great-grandfather Prince Philipin March 2022 and thefuneral for their great-grandmother Queen Elizabethin September.

It was recently announced thatPrince Georgewill have abig roleat his grandfatherKing Charles' upcoming coronation on May 6. The young royal, who is second in line to the throne, is set to be a page for the King at the historic ceremony.

“His parents are very excited and delighted that he is a page,” a spokesperson for the Prince and Princess of Wales tells PEOPLE. “It’s something that his parents have thought long and hard about and are very much looking forward to — and I’m sure George is, too.”
